A tragedy at the Derby and the aftermath!!!

This past Saturday history was made in the Kentucky Derby. Unfortunately some of it was tragic. The beautiful filly Eight Belles who came in a very game second broke down at the top of the turn into the backstretch. No one in the grandstand knew what had happened at first but then they saw the horse ambulance go by. Then word started spreading and the jubilant celebration of Big Brown's win suddenly became somber. Eight Belles had broken both front ankles in a bizarre accident. Dr. Larry Bramlag… Continue
